About Midway Village Museum
Midway Village Museum is a history museum in Rockford, IL. Its Main Museum Center features over 20,000 square feet of gallery spaces with interactive exhibits, including the "Many Faces, One Community" exhibit showcasing the immigrant experience. The museum offers history-themed programs for all ages, covering periods from early pioneer settlement through World War II, and houses artifacts from Rockford’s Camp Grant. A golf cart is available for improved campus accessibility.
